Programs Offered by University
Bachelor of Business Studies (BBS)
A four-year annual program designed to develop students into competent managers for any sector of organized activity.
- Level: Bachelors (Undergraduate)
- Duration: 4 Years
- Eligibility: 10+2 or equivalent with minimum D+ in all subjects.
- Careers: Banking, Accounting, Marketing, Entrepreneurship.
Bachelor of Education (B.Ed)
A four-year program aimed at producing qualified and trained teachers and educational administrators.
- Level: Bachelors (Undergraduate)
- Duration: 4 Years
- Eligibility: 10+2 in Education or equivalent stream.
- Careers: School Teaching, Educational Planning, Content Development.

Faculty & Teaching Methodology
The academic strength of Kshitiz College lies in its experienced and dedicated faculty members. Many instructors bring years of academic and professional experience in management and pedagogical sciences. The teaching methodology goes beyond traditional lecturing to include:
- Case-based learning for BBS students to understand real-world business scenarios.
- Practical teaching sessions and micro-teaching for B.Ed students to hone instructional skills.
- Frequent seminars and guest lectures by industry experts and veteran educators.
- Regular internal assessments and feedback sessions to monitor student progress.

Career Support & Placement Assistance
Internship Opportunities
BBS students are encouraged to undertake internships in local banks, cooperatives, and business houses in Rajbiraj to gain practical exposure.
Teaching Practicum
B.Ed students undergo intensive teaching practices in local schools, providing them with the necessary experience to join the teaching workforce immediately after graduation.
